I would recheck. If they are two separate wires with individual terminals, If you separate the wires and still read a short or .3 on both wires, solenoid is probably OK but if you now have no continuity on one wire with bulb still in socket, then time to find out why. If the wires are tied together on a single terminal, then remove the bulb from dash and same scenario. No continuity, find out why.

Almost anything mechanically wrong will most likely mean OD/trans comes out for evaluation or repair. Really need to make sure the solenoid is at least trying to come in or it tries to go into OD before going into mechanical things. I don't believe you mentioned whether you have heard it yet. The relay box will click when 5 grounded but there should also be a louder clunk, thud or heavier click from under the car.
